What works for me....well as the mother of small kids staying organized (or maybe I really am just obsessive compulsive.....not sure which, the story I am going with is I have four girls;) is a must.  We have added several new ways to stay organized this year.  I am bad about not keeping up with my day planner but my funny friend Sara of Scraps of Sara fame made me one several moons ago, that I am diligently trying to keep up with.  So much so that I have even removed the original one and added in a new one for this year.  Aside from that I am normally a list keeper, "things to do" type usually.  This year to get more organized and have everyone doing their part, myself and several of my home school mom friends' implemented a new chore/reward system for our younger kids called " I did my chores" which BTW, is working beautifully here and my younger girls' are even doing things not on their regular tags YAY. As well as the extra tags have become my "to do list" so that I don't have scraps of paper all over the place anymore.  I keep them tacked to the wall over my desk so as KK and I get things done we move our tags too. The thing I am keeping the most on top of is my menu calendar.  I feel like our household gets in a rut with eating the same things over and over so I started keeping a separate calendar from the one I use for keeping everyone's appointments/activities organized where I am just writing in what we have for dinner.  This has helped me when deciding what to have for dinner so as to not repeat meals quite so often.
